Cousin Tony's Brand New Firebird release their uplifting third studio album Smiles of Earth

 
 

Today, indie favorites Cousin Tony’s Brand New Firebird release their latest album Smiles Of Earth; their most stylistically cohesive, organic and collaborative statement to date. The record exudes warmth and showcases an increased use of horns across 10 gorgeous songs; ranging from observational, whimsical and quirky to deeply moving ruminations on love lost (and found). It includes the singles,When This Is Over’, ‘Bluestone’,  ‘Red Dirt Angel’ and new single ‘Every Morning, It Breaks’.

“Like most albums, Smiles of Earth has been a labour of deep love. Thwarted by lockdowns and the creative process itself, we attempted to make this record in numerous ways. Thanks to the patience and dedication of the band members, as well as the nurturing talents of producer Stephen Charles, the album was finally realised at The Aviary in Abbotsford, Melbourne. The inner themes of peacefulness and positive perspective truly levitated the performers throughout the recording process and they embodied its spirit wholeheartedly. I think that spirit is now undeniable in the sound of the album. In a word, this album was written to make you smile”.   – Lachlan Rose (frontperson - Cousin Tony’s Brand New Firebird).

Smiles Of Earth was produced by Stephen Charles and Lachlan Rose with additional engineering by Harry Leithhead and Guy Faletolu. Award-winning engineer Matthew Neighbour (Matt Corby, The Avalanches, Middle Kids) took the final reins for the mix and it was mastered by George Georgiadis.

“As the name leans towards, ‘Smiles of Earth’ comes from a place of inherent peacefulness. Inspired by Albert Camus’ ‘The Myth of Sisyphus’, the phrase captures the natural beauty of the world we live in, which is ever-present but not necessarily always appreciated. While the songs certainly explore the struggles involved in obtaining these positive perspectives, the overall feeling I wanted to leave people with was the choice. The choice between meaninglessness and beauty”.  – Lachlan Rose
